Tenders are invited by the Hutt River Board for lease of an area of six acres of land in neighbourhood of Maby's Road, Taita. By advertisement in this Issue, the Lower Hutt Borough Council warns residents against the use of garden hoses except when held in the hand. This course has been found necessary as the residents in the outlying districts have difficulty in getting sufficient water for domestic purposes. ' By advertisement in this issue, the Housing Construction Department call for tenders for construction of roads and stormwiter sewers in the Mearing and Johnson Blocks, Lower Hutt.
